THE RED SCARE - Smoky Mountain High DLP Drums now repressed on Stoned to'Smoky Mountain High' is the discography release from the late 90s Knoxville hardcore band, The Red Scare. Formed by college friends Matt Hall (drums), Kip Uhlhorn (guitar vocals), Abby Wintker (bass), and Adam Ewing (guitar) in August of 1997. In 1998, Jon Asher replaced Adam Ewing on guitar. They began playing locally; building a name for themselves, with short, hyper energetic sets similar to those of Sleepytime Trio from Virginia and Gravity
